Tell me what kind of experience do you have with XYZ language?

If you're applying for a development or design job, you'll almost certainly be asked how familiar you are with a particular programming language. Unless you're applying for a senior developer position, you don't necessarily have to be an expert at the particular language in most cases to get hired.

What you do need to show is that you're very comfortable with it, and that you're happy to dive in to learn what you don't know. It's more important that you show that you're familiar with coding on a conceptual level, and have good problem-solving abilities. But just because you've worked more with Rails than Python doesn't mean you can't get a junior developer job if you show that you can quickly figure out problems and how to solve them.
